Guide

Unlocking Transformation in Machine Learning: A Guide

In this comprehensive guide, we will delve into the exciting world of transformation in machine learning. We will explore how this groundbreaking technology is revolutionizing data processing, and take a closer look at the cutting-edge techniques used in this thrilling field.

Understanding the Basics of Machine Learning

Before we dive into the transformational aspects of machine learning, let’s first establish a solid understanding of the basics. Machine learning, in simple terms, is a subset of artificial intelligence that uses algorithms to enable machines to learn from data and make predictions or decisions without being explicitly programmed.

At the heart of machine learning are three key elements: data, models, and algorithms. A machine learning model is created by training an algorithm on a dataset, enabling it to make predictions or decisions on unseen data. The algorithm learns from the data, refining its parameters until the model achieves the desired level of accuracy.

There are three main types of machine learning: supervised learning, unsupervised learning, and reinforcement learning. Supervised learning involves using labeled data to train algorithms, while unsupervised learning involves using unlabeled data to identify patterns and relationships. Reinforcement learning involves using a rewards-based system to train machines to make decisions.

In order to effectively utilize machine learning, it is important to have a strong foundation in statistical analysis, data preprocessing, and programming languages such as Python or R. By gaining a solid understanding of the basics of machine learning, we can better appreciate the transformative potential of the field.

The Power of  Transformation in Machine Learning

Transformation in Machine Learning
Transformation in Machine Learning

Transformation is at the heart of the power and potential of machine learning. In this section, we will explore why transformation is crucial in machine learning algorithms and how it enhances data processing capabilities.

At its most basic level, transformation involves converting input data into a new format that can be better analyzed and understood by machine learning algorithms. By transforming data, we can make it easier for algorithms to identify patterns, extract meaningful insights, and make predictions.

The power of transformation lies in its ability to enable unprecedented data analysis and decision-making. By applying different transformation techniques, we can refine and optimize input data, making it more suitable for a given machine learning algorithm. This results in more accurate and insightful results which, in turn, can drive transformative outcomes.

For example, one common transformation technique is feature scaling, which involves rescaling input data to ensure that all features have similar ranges. By doing so, we can prevent any one feature from dominating the analysis and enable the algorithm to more accurately weigh each feature’s importance.

Other types of transformations include dimensionality reduction, which involves reducing the number of features to simplify the dataset, and data augmentation, which involves creating new data points based on existing ones to expand the dataset. Each transformation technique contributes to refining and optimizing data, unlocking the transformative potential of machine learning.

Keep Reading   How to Cancel Express VPN: Quick Guide

Maximizing the Benefits of Transformation

While transformation offers immense potential, realizing its benefits requires careful consideration and planning. To maximize the power of transformation in machine learning, it’s essential to choose the right techniques for a given dataset and ensure that they are applied correctly.

One key consideration is to ensure consistency in the transformation process. Data inconsistency can lead to inaccurate results and reduce the effectiveness of the transformation. Additionally, selecting the right features to transform can also be a challenge. Feature selection is a critical component of machine learning, and choosing the wrong features can lead to inaccurate results and wasted resources.

Finally, it’s essential to ensure that transformations are interpretable, meaning that we can extract meaningful insights from the output. Machine learning models can be complex, and it’s important to make sure that we can understand and interpret the results to make informed decisions.

By overcoming these challenges and leveraging the power of transformation in machine learning, we can unlock new insights and drive transformative outcomes. Join us on this journey to embrace the transformative possibilities of machine learning today!

Exploring Different Types of Transformations

In machine learning, transformation techniques play a critical role in refining and optimizing data to produce more accurate predictions and insights. Let’s take a closer look at some of the most common types of transformations used in machine learning.

Feature Scaling

Feature scaling is a technique used to normalize the range of values in a feature or variable. This is important because some machine learning algorithms are sensitive to the scale of the input data. Feature scaling ensures that each feature has an equal impact on the model’s output, regardless of the scale of the original data. Common feature scaling techniques include min-max scaling, mean normalization, and z-score standardization.

Dimensionality Reduction

Dimensionality reduction is the process of reducing the number of features in a dataset while retaining as much of the original information as possible. This technique is useful for dealing with high-dimensional datasets, which can be computationally expensive and difficult to interpret. Common dimensionality reduction techniques include principal component analysis (PCA), linear discriminant analysis (LDA), and t-distributed stochastic neighbor embedding (t-SNE).

Data Augmentation

Data augmentation is a process of artificially increasing the size of a dataset by creating new examples that are similar to the original data. This technique is particularly useful in deep learning, where large amounts of data are required to train complex models. Data augmentation techniques include image rotations, flips, and color adjustments for image data, and textual paraphrasing and back-translation for language data.

By understanding the different types of transformations available in machine learning, you can select the most appropriate technique for your data and optimize your machine learning algorithms for better results.

Implementing Transformation Techniques in Machine Learning

Now that we have explored the different types of transformations in machine learning, it’s time to learn how to implement them effectively in our machine learning algorithms. By doing so, we can ensure accurate and insightful results that can drive transformative outcomes.

Firstly, it is important to understand the specific use case for each transformation technique. For example, feature scaling is often used when features have different ranges of values, while dimensionality reduction is useful for reducing the complexity of datasets with many features. By selecting the appropriate technique for our data, we can optimize our machine learning algorithms and produce better results.

Next, we can incorporate the selected transformation techniques into our machine learning workflows. This can be done using libraries such as Scikit-learn, Pandas, and NumPy. For instance, we can use the MinMaxScaler function from Scikit-learn to scale our features to a specific range.

It is important to remember that transformation techniques should not be applied blindly. Instead, we should carefully evaluate the impact of each technique on our data and algorithms. This can be done by comparing the performance of our machine learning models with and without the implemented transformations. If the transformation leads to an improvement in accuracy or efficiency, it can be considered successful.

Keep Reading   Way Does VPN Slow Down Internet Speed For iPhone

Finally, it is important to stay up to date with the latest advancements in transformation techniques. This can be done by reading research papers, attending conferences, and following industry leaders. By doing so, we can continue to refine our machine learning workflows and unlock new possibilities for transformative outcomes.

Overcoming Challenges in Transformation for Machine Learning

As with any emerging field, transformation in machine learning presents various challenges. By addressing these challenges head-on, we can leverage the full potential of transformational techniques and achieve optimal outcomes.

Data Inconsistency

One key challenge in applying transformations in machine learning is dealing with inconsistencies in data. Different sources of data may have varying formats, missing values, or outliers that can affect the accuracy of transformation techniques. To overcome this, we can implement data cleansing procedures to remove outliers and fill in missing values, ensuring that the data is consistent and ready for transformation.

Feature Selection

Another challenge is selecting the right features for transformation. Depending on the type of transformation used, certain features may have a more significant impact on the outcome than others. It is crucial to carefully evaluate which features are most relevant to the problem at hand and which transformations will have the greatest impact on the results. Feature selection techniques, such as correlation analysis, can help identify the most relevant features for transformation.

Model Interpretation

Transformations can also make it challenging to interpret the results of machine learning models. The transformed data may be difficult to understand or visualize, making it challenging to draw insights from the model. To address this, we can use techniques such as partial dependence plots and local interpretable model-agnostic explanations (LIME) to visualize the impact of transformations on the model’s output and gain a better understanding of the results.

By acknowledging and addressing these challenges, we can maximize the potential of transformation in machine learning and unlock new insights into our data. Let’s continue to explore this exciting field and discover the transformative possibilities that lie ahead.

Advancements in Transformation Techniques

As the field of machine learning continues to grow, so do the advancements in transformation techniques. Innovators and researchers are constantly exploring new approaches to refine and optimize data processing, enabling even more transformative outcomes.

The Emergence of Deep Learning

One of the most exciting advancements in transformation techniques is the emergence of deep learning. This approach utilizes artificial neural networks to enable more complex data analysis and decision-making. With deep learning, machine learning algorithms can analyze vast amounts of data and identify intricate patterns and relationships that were previously impossible to detect.

The Integration of Reinforcement Learning

Reinforcement learning is another transformative technique that has gained significant traction in recent years. This approach enables machine learning algorithms to learn from their environment and adapt their decision-making based on feedback. Reinforcement learning has found practical applications in autonomous vehicles, robotics, and game development, among other industries.

The Exploration of Transfer Learning

Transfer learning is a technique that utilizes pre-trained models to enable faster and more efficient machine learning workflows. By utilizing pre-existing models, machine learning algorithms can leverage the knowledge already gained from previous data sets to enhance their performance on new data sets. This approach has gained popularity in natural language processing and computer vision applications.

The Rise of Quantum Machine Learning

Quantum machine learning is an emerging field that utilizes the principles of quantum computing to enhance machine learning workflows. This approach enables machine learning algorithms to analyze vast amounts of data in parallel and generate more accurate predictions and insights. While still in its early stages, quantum machine learning holds immense potential for revolutionizing data processing and decision-making.

Keep Reading   How to Tell Chat GPT to Learn Something, The Beginning Step

The Promise of Explainable AI

Explainable AI is a growing field that aims to enhance the transparency and interpretability of machine learning algorithms. By providing clear and detailed explanations for how machine learning models make decisions, explainable AI can increase user trust and enable more effective decision-making. This approach has found applications in industries such as healthcare and finance, where explainable decision-making is crucial.

As the field of transformation in machine learning continues to evolve, it’s important to stay updated on the latest advancements and emerging trends. By doing so, we can unlock even more transformative possibilities and drive innovation across a range of industries.

Real-life Applications of Transformation in Machine Learning

Incorporating transformation techniques in machine learning algorithms has paved the way for numerous practical applications across various industries.

Healthcare

One of the most significant applications of machine learning transformations in healthcare is the development of predictive models for disease diagnosis and treatment. With the help of feature selection and data augmentation, healthcare professionals can gain valuable insights into patient data, leading to more accurate diagnoses and personalized treatment plans.

Finance

Machine learning transformations have transformed the finance industry by enhancing fraud detection, portfolio management, and risk assessment. By implementing dimensionality reduction and feature scaling techniques, financial institutions can analyze large datasets more efficiently, resulting in improved investment decisions and reduced fraud.

Agriculture

Transformations in machine learning have also found application in the agriculture sector. By utilizing image processing techniques and data augmentation, farmers can analyze large amounts of data, such as soil quality and crop maturity. This helps optimize crop yields while ensuring sustainable farming practices.

These are just a few examples of how transformation in machine learning has been put to practical use in real-life scenarios. As the field continues to evolve and new techniques emerge, we can expect to see even more innovative applications of machine learning transformations in the future.

Conclusion

There you have it – our comprehensive guide to unlocking the potential of transformation in machine learning. Throughout this journey, we’ve explored the basics of machine learning and how it works, the power of transformation in enhancing data processing capabilities, different types of transformations, strategies for implementing them effectively, challenges encountered, and advancements in transformation techniques.

Now armed with this knowledge, we can leverage the transformative possibilities of machine learning to gain new insights and drive innovation across various industries. By staying updated with emerging trends and continuing to learn and experiment with transformational techniques, we can unlock even greater potential in the future.

Thank you for joining us on this exciting journey, and we look forward to exploring further possibilities with you in the world of transformation in machine learning.

FAQ

What is transformation in machine learning?

Transformation in machine learning refers to the process of manipulating and altering data to enhance its quality, relevance, or structure. It involves applying various techniques to modify the input data and optimize it for analysis and modeling.

Why is transformation important in machine learning algorithms?

Transformation plays a crucial role in machine learning algorithms as it helps improve data quality, reduce noise, normalize features, and enable better model performance. It allows algorithms to make more accurate predictions and extract meaningful insights from the data.

What are the different types of transformations used in machine learning?

There are several types of transformations commonly used in machine learning, including feature scaling, dimensionality reduction, one-hot encoding, data normalization, and data augmentation. Each transformation technique serves a specific purpose and contributes to optimizing the data for analysis and modeling.

How can I implement transformation techniques in my machine learning workflows?

To implement transformation techniques in your machine learning workflows, you need to understand the specific requirements of your data and the goals of your analysis. You can apply transformation techniques using libraries and frameworks such as scikit-learn in Python or by customizing your own transformation functions.

What challenges can arise when applying transformations in machine learning?

Applying transformations in machine learning can present challenges such as handling missing data, dealing with outliers, selecting appropriate transformation techniques, and ensuring consistency across different datasets. It’s important to carefully handle these challenges to ensure the accurate and reliable application of transformations.

Related Articles

Back to top button